[gtk/wip/matthiasc/focus2: 90/91] Make gtk_widget_get_focus_child public



commit 469f038c0024beb563bc03a1675e45e2207c5c33
Author: Matthias Clasen <mclasen redhat com>
Date:   Fri Mar 8 13:46:17 2019 -0500

    Make gtk_widget_get_focus_child public
    
    I want to use it in a test, if nothing else.

 gtk/gtkwidget.h        | 3 +++
 gtk/gtkwidgetprivate.h | 2 --
 2 files changed, 3 insertions(+), 2 deletions(-)
---
diff --git a/gtk/gtkwidget.h b/gtk/gtkwidget.h
index 438ef53011..c7581e77c0 100644
--- a/gtk/gtkwidget.h
+++ b/gtk/gtkwidget.h
@@ -1070,6 +1070,9 @@ void                    gtk_widget_insert_before        (GtkWidget *widget,
 GDK_AVAILABLE_IN_ALL
 void                    gtk_widget_set_focus_child      (GtkWidget *widget,
                                                          GtkWidget *child);
+GDK_AVAILABLE_IN_ALL
+GtkWidget *             gtk_widget_get_focus_child      (GtkWidget *widget);
+
 GDK_AVAILABLE_IN_ALL
 void                    gtk_widget_set_child_focusable  (GtkWidget *widget,
                                                          gboolean   focusable);
diff --git a/gtk/gtkwidgetprivate.h b/gtk/gtkwidgetprivate.h
index 543173e8e0..c5f6949d16 100644
--- a/gtk/gtkwidgetprivate.h
+++ b/gtk/gtkwidgetprivate.h
@@ -318,8 +318,6 @@ void              gtk_widget_forall                        (GtkWidget
                                                             GtkCallback           callback,
                                                             gpointer              user_data);
 
-GtkWidget        *gtk_widget_get_focus_child               (GtkWidget            *widget);
-
 void              gtk_widget_focus_sort                    (GtkWidget        *widget,
                                                             GtkDirectionType  direction,
                                                             GPtrArray        *focus_order);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]